                                  @SGaist, The same as the original poster's one:

                                  Project ERROR: failed to parse default search paths from compiler output
                                  Error while parsing file path/to/project.pro. Giving up.

                                  Going to Build > Run qmake was failing too. After simply running qmake in the terminal, it started working.

                                  It was not creating the Run configuration at all, even after cleaning git ignored files (like the .pro.user file for example) and configuring a Build configuration.
